The manufacturers buy screens by the thousands or in a few cases by the millions so they get a good price. They sell the devices by the thousands/millions so can have a smaller profit per unit and still make money.
Replacement parts for many things cost a lot when compared to the price of a new unit especially when it is on sale. I wanted to buy a replacement for the dust bin in my (cheap) vacuum and it had to be special ordered and with shipping cost $10 more than a new vacuum.
